You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
As per the docs, we can add Redis to the configuration for enabling caching.
However when adding it, the requests starts to fail with the error: Error: Socket already opened from RedisSocker.connect
Database
PostgreSQL
Relevant log output
umami |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:492:471)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:492:293)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| ⨯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:492:471)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:492:293)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:364:387)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:364:234)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| ⨯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:364:387)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:364:234)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:492:471)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:492:293)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| ⨯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:492:471)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:492:293)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:364:387)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:364:234)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| ⨯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:364:387)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:364:234)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
umami | Error: Socket already opened
umami | at RedisSocket.connect (/app/node_modules/@redis/client/dist/lib/client/socket.js:48:19)
umami | at Commander.connect (/app/node_modules/@redis/client/dist/lib/client/index.js:184:70)
umami | at UmamiRedisClient.connect (/app/node_modules/@umami/redis-client/dist/index.js:47:25)
umami | at UmamiRedisClient.get (/app/node_modules/@umami/redis-client/dist/index.js:53:16)
umami | at UmamiRedisClient.fetch (/app/node_modules/@umami/redis-client/dist/index.js:86:31)
umami | at d (/app/.next/server/chunks/6711.js:1:17133)
umami | at b (/app/.next/server/chunks/6711.js:1:20401)
umami | at u (/app/.next/server/chunks/6711.js:492:471)
umami | at Object.prisma (/app/.next/server/chunks/6711.js:492:293)
umami | at u (/app/.next/server/chunks/6711.js:1:13692)
Which Umami version are you using? (if relevant)
2.15.1
Which browser are you using? (if relevant)
No response
How are you deploying your application? (if relevant)
Vercel and Docker
The text was updated successfully, but these errors were encountered:
Describe the Bug
As per the docs, we can add Redis to the configuration for enabling caching.
However when adding it, the requests starts to fail with the error:
Error: Socket already opened
from RedisSocker.connectDatabase
PostgreSQL
Relevant log output
Which Umami version are you using? (if relevant)
2.15.1
Which browser are you using? (if relevant)
No response
How are you deploying your application? (if relevant)
Vercel and Docker
The text was updated successfully, but these errors were encountered: